Mrs. Kemi Badenoch, Leader of the United Kingdom Conservative Party, has recounted her encounters with some members of the Nigeria Police Force (NPF) while in Nigeria.
In a recent interview with The Free Press, which attracted significant attention, she expressed her trust in the British police, contrasting it with her negative experiences in Nigeria.
Badenoch stated, “My experience with the police in Nigeria was very negative,” and noted that her initial interactions with UK law enforcement were quite positive, highlighting that the Nigeria police had engaged in corrupt practices, including theft.

She recalled a specific incident where her brother’s shoes and watch were stolen, emphasising the dire circumstances that lead individuals to such actions.
